返回

文章详情

简单HTML的非合理有效性

Hacker News2026年6月11日 22:17

我在会议上讲过这个故事——但由于目前的普遍情况,我想在这里重新讲述。几年前,我在伦敦的一家住房福利办公室进行政策研究。那是一种特别不讨人喜欢的地方。墙壁上张贴着提供帮助服务的海报,专门为逃离家庭暴力的人们提供帮助。门口的保安对进入的人表现得谨慎而漠不关心。空气中充满了伴侣之间紧张的谈话——被尖叫的孩子们的噪声淹没。中间,一名年轻女子坐在一把硬塑料椅子上。她的身边围着装有她世俗财物的帆布袋。此刻她看起来情绪并不好。她手中紧握着一个游戏机——PSP(PlayStation Portable)。她紧盯着屏幕,试图用《糖果传奇》屏蔽外界。或者,至少,我是这样想的。走到她身后,我瞥了一眼她的游戏机,认出了她正浏览的屏幕。她连接着免费的WiFi,正在浏览关于住房福利的GOV.UK页面。她不是在切水果,而是在为自己武装知识。PSP的网页浏览器—宽容地说—令人失望。它运行缓慢,内存经常不足,一次只能打开三个标签。但GOV.UK页面是用简单的HTML编写的。它们旨在轻量级,即使在劣质浏览器上也能正常工作。它们必须如此。这是为了所有人。并不是每个人都有大显示器,或者多核CPU狂飙特拉弗,或者宽带连接。摄影师Chase Jarvis创造了“最好的相机是随身携带的那一台”的说法。他的意思是,在重要时刻带着一台差劲的即影即有相机,总比把世界上最好的相机锁在车里要好。网页浏览器也是如此。如果你有一台智能电视,它可能有一个糟糕的浏览器。我的旧车里装有一个内置的糟糕网页浏览器。两者都很痛苦使用——但它们的确能工作!如果你的笔记本电脑和手机都被偷了——你多容易就能通过你拥有的最差浏览器进行在线生活?如果你需要在线提交保险索赔——你会收到一个简单的HTML表单来填写,还是一个无法渲染的DOCX文件?有什么重要的信息或服务因为被困在PDF或极其复杂的网站中而被禁止访问?你在开发公共服务吗?或者当人们急需帮助时可能会接触到的系统?简单的HTML有效。一小部分简单的CSS可以让它看起来不错。JavaScript可能不必要——但可以用来渐进增强内容。给图片添加替代文本,以便按MB付费的人能理解这些图片的用途(以及你知道的,便于无障碍访问)。去坐在一把不舒服的椅子上,在一个不舒服的地方,盯着一个不舒服的小屏幕,使用一个过时的网页浏览器。你创建的网站使用起来有多容易?我在之后与那位年轻女子简短交谈。她被父母赶了出来,朋友们给了她去住房福利办公室的车费。她对工作人员的帮助仅有的赞美。我问起PSP——是从哥哥那里传下来的——以及该网页浏览器。她的回答是:“它不好。但可以用。”我想这就是我们所能努力追求的目标。以下是关于访问GOV.UK的游戏机的一些统计数据。

赞助内容

NordVPN Next-gen Antivirus

本站免费、广告极少。如果觉得有帮助,可以请我们喝杯咖啡 —— 任何金额都对持续运营有实际帮助。

请我喝杯咖啡